Book List

Below is the elementary level OBOB book list for all 3rd, 4th, and 5th graders for the 2022-23 OBOB season.  Multiple copies of all titles can be found in the Byrom school library and Tualatin public library (availability may vary depending on popularity!):

  • The Best of Iggy by Annie Barrows
  • The Dragon with a Chocolate Heart by Stephanie Burgis
  • From the Desk of Zoe Washington by Janae Marks
  • Harbor Me by Jacqueline Woodson
  • Kinda Like Brothers by Coe Booth
  • Letters from Cuba by Ruth Behar
  • Me, Frida, and the Secret of the Peacock Ring by Angela Cervantes
  • Measuring Up by Lily LaMotte & Ann Xu
  • Rescue on the Oregon Trail by Kate Messner
  • Shirley and Jamila Save Their Summer by Gillian Goerz
  • Small Steps: The Year I Got Polio by Peg Kehret
  • Snapdragon by Kat Leyh
  • Spark by Sarah Beth Durst
  • Ten by Shamini Flint
  • The Trouble with Weasels by Rob Harrell
  • A Wish in the Dark by Christina Soontornvat

What is OBOB?

The Oregon Battle of the Books, or OBOB, is a free statewide voluntary reading and comprehension program sponsored by the Oregon Association of School Libraries and locally by the Byrom PSO.  Students in 3rd, 4th and 5th grades are divided into teams and encouraged to read from a list of sixteen books which represent a variety of styles and viewpoints.  A “battle” is a scored trivia competition between two teams of 4-6 students each who take turns answering questions from all the OBOB books.

OBOB’s mission is to encourage and recognize students who enjoy reading, to broaden reading interests, to increase reading comprehension, promote academic excellence, expose students to diversity, and to promote cooperative learning and teamwork among students.

How does OBOB work at Byrom?

OBOB at Byrom is a volunteer run extracurricular program that is held once a week during lunch and lunch recess (specific days TBA).  Beginning in late October, OBOBers will meet to discuss books, participate in comprehension activities, and practice battles.  Beginning in January, the Byrom teams will begin official battles to determine a winning team to represent Byrom Elementary at the OBOB regional tournament.  Regional tournaments have historically taken place in early to mid March.
